Motorways shut after body found on M4 near Bristol. Police investigate how the person ended up on the road.

The body was between junctions 20 and 21. That’s close to Almondsbury Interchange. It’s also near Awkley. Drivers called the police around 6:40 PM, reporting they saw something on the road. Police arrived and found human remains there.
The M4 and M48 closed for investigation. Both roads have now reopened. Police are trying to identify this person and find the family. Cops are figuring out how someone ended up on the road.
The closures affected areas near two bridges: the Severn Bridge M48 and the Prince of Wales Bridge. The Severn Crossing stayed open during the closure. Traffic Officers turned cars around, with police assistance, said National Highways.
One driver posted online that their family was stuck since 7 PM, without supplies. Another person said her parents were stuck, too. They needed facilities. National Highways said turning vehicles around took time and was complex due to the volume.
Drivers were warned not to turn around themselves because it was too dangerous. Use caution and wait for police. The M5 link also closed. It connected south to M4’s junction 20 west.
They advised drivers going between England and Wales to prepare. Expect long delays on those routes. The M4 closed between junctions 20 and 22, between Almondsbury and the Severn Bridges. The M48 closed between junction 1 and the M4 itself. The M5 link from junction 15 south to M4 junction 20 west closed. A link from M5 junction 16 north to M4 junction 20 west also shut.
